Particularly unfortunate circumstances led to the death of a 38-year-old on Friday morning during logging operations in the Tyrolean municipality of Pfunds. The man died when felling a tree.
It was around 10 a.m. when the 38-year-old, together with a 63-year-old, was carrying out felling work in the so-called Eggele forest near Pfunds. The men tried to pull up a tree with a winch as it fell.
Died at the scene of the accident
During this maneuver, the tree hit a hilltop, the trunk broke and hit the 38-year-old with full force. He was so seriously injured that he died at the scene of the accident. Emergency doctor, fire brigade, mountain rescue and police were present. They could only recover the man’s body.
